High-performance roller bearing
Technical field
This utility model relates to roller bearing technical field, especially a kind of high-performance roller bearing.
Background technology
Along with the development of industry, roller bearing is widely used in various industry field.Roller bearing is applicable to Under the operating mode of heavy load and impact load, different design organizations is very big on bearing load carrying capacity impact, current bearing inner race And there is between outer ring gap, dust is easy to enter into inside from gap, adheres to, with on rolling element, produce the biggest making an uproar Sound, and affect the service life of bearing.
Utility model content
The technical problems to be solved in the utility model is: in order to solve have between prior art middle (center) bearing inner ring and outer ring Gap, dust is easy to enter into inside from gap, adheres to and on rolling element, the problem producing the biggest noise, existing offer A kind of high-performance roller bearing.
This utility model solves its technical problem and be the technical scheme is that a kind of high-performance roller bearing, including interior Circle and outer ring, be provided with rolling chamber between described inner ring and outer ring, described rolling intracavity is provided with rolling element, and described inner ring is with outer Being formed between circle and roll the gap that chamber connects, the both sides being positioned at described rolling element in described gap are respectively arranged with a circle Ring, the inner side of described annulus contacts with described inner ring, and the outside of described annulus contacts with described outer ring, and the both sides of described inner ring are equal Being provided with a fixed plate, it is spacing that described fixed plate is provided with first matched with described annulus near the side of described inner ring Plate, the both sides that the outer circumference surface of described inner ring is positioned at described rolling element are provided with second limiting plate, described rolling element The annulus of both sides is respectively positioned between the first limiting plate of its side, place and the second limiting plate, two described annulus, inner ring and outer ring Between formed shoe cream room.
Arranging two annulus in gap between outer ring and inner ring in this programme, the inner side of annulus contacts with inner ring, circle The outside of ring contacts with outer ring so that two annulus, form shoe cream room between inner ring and outer ring, adds lubrication in shoe cream room Oil so that rolling element and annulus are sufficiently lubricated, reduces friction, and on the one hand two annulus can enter oil storage with blocks dust Chamber, the lubricating oil interior to it pollutes, and on the other hand annulus can improve the bearing capacity of bearing, this outer stationary plates greatly Can stop a part of dust, wherein the first limiting plate and the second limiting plate are for axially positioning rolling element.
For the ease of oil addition in shoe cream room, further, the lateral surface of described outer ring is provided with oil filler point, Described oil filler point connects with described shoe cream room, and described oil filler point is provided with plug.
Preferably, it is connected by screw is fixing between described fixed plate with described inner ring.
The beneficial effects of the utility model are: high-performance roller bearing of the present utility model is by arranging circle in gap Ring so that two annulus, form shoe cream room between inner ring and outer ring, shoe cream room is used for storing lubricating oil so that rolling element and circle Ring is sufficiently lubricated, and reduces rolling element and the pivoting friction resistance of annulus, and two annulus the most effectively prevent dust to enter Entering shoe cream room, annulus greatly improves the bearing capacity of bearing simultaneously.

Detailed description of the invention
Presently in connection with accompanying drawing, this utility model is described in further detail.These accompanying drawings are the schematic diagram of simplification, Basic structure of the present utility model is described the most in a schematic way, and therefore it only shows the composition relevant with this utility model.
Embodiment 1
As illustrated in fig. 1 and 2, a kind of high-performance roller bearing, including inner ring 1 and outer ring 2, between described inner ring 1 and outer ring 2 Being provided with rolling chamber, described rolling intracavity is provided with rolling element 3, is formed and rolls chamber and connect between described inner ring 1 and outer ring 2 Gap 4, the both sides being positioned at described rolling element 3 in described gap 4 are respectively arranged with an annulus 5, and the cross section of annulus 5 is circle Shape, the inner side of described annulus 5 contacts with described inner ring 1, and the outside of described annulus 5 contacts with described outer ring 2, described inner ring 1 Both sides are provided with a fixed plate 6, and described fixed plate 6 is provided with near the side of described inner ring 1 and matches with described annulus 5 The first limiting plate 7, the outer circumference surface of described inner ring 1 is positioned at the both sides of described rolling element 3 be provided with one second spacing Plate 8, the annulus 5 of described rolling element 3 both sides is respectively positioned between the first limiting plate 7 and second limiting plate 8 of its side, place, two institutes State formation shoe cream room 9 between annulus 5, inner ring 1 and outer ring 2, the first limiting plate 7 and the second limiting plate 8 for by fixed for rolling element 3 Position, the first limiting plate 7 and the second limiting plate 8 are all in circular arc, and fixed plate 6 is ringwise.
Being provided with oil filler point 10 on the lateral surface of described outer ring 2, described oil filler point 10 connects with described shoe cream room 9, described Plug 11 is installed on oil filler point 10, plug 11 is taken away, lubricating oil can be injected in shoe cream room 9.
It is connected by screw 12 is fixing between described fixed plate 6 with described inner ring 1.
Above-mentioned high-performance roller bearing arranges two annulus 5 in the gap 4 between outer ring 2 and inner ring 1, annulus 5 Inner side contacts with inner ring 1, and the outside of annulus 5 contacts with outer ring 2 so that two annulus 5, formation oil storages between inner ring 1 and outer ring 2 Chamber 9, adds lubricating oil beforehand through oil filler point 10 so that rolling element 3 and annulus 5 are sufficiently lubricated, and subtract in shoe cream room 9 Few friction, two annulus 5 one aspects blocks dust can enter shoe cream room 9, and the lubricating oil interior to it pollutes, on the other hand Annulus 5 can improve the bearing capacity of bearing greatly, and this outer stationary plates 6 can stop a part of dust.
